Annabelle Macmillan 1880 - 1976

Annabelle Macmillan of Ridge, Suffolk County, NY was born on March 19, 1880, and died at age 95 years old in February 1976.

Did you know?
In 1880, in the year that Annabelle Macmillan was born, in October, the "Blizzard of 1880" began in North America - considered the most severe winter ever known in the US. Many areas were snowbound throughout the whole winter, which was made famous in Laura Ingalls Wilder's book The Long Winter.
Did you know?
In 1934, at the age of 54 years old, Annabelle was alive when on June 6th, the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ission was formed as a response to the stock market crash of 1929 and the continuing Great Depression. Previously, the states regulated the offering and sales of stocks - called "blue sky" laws. They were largely ineffective. Roosevelt created a group (one member was Joseph Kennedy, father of the future President Kennedy) who knew Wall Street well and they defined the mission and operating mode for the SEC. The new organization had broad and stringent rules and oversight and restored public confidence in the stock market in the United States.
